在AEP中编辑Snowflake数据流时Source连接超时

本文解决在 选择数据 步骤中编辑Snowflake Source数据流时Adobe Experience Platform中的Snowflake连接超时问题。 解决方法涉及识别并解决底层SQL查询中的性能瓶颈,并调整仓库大小以缩短查询执行时间。

描述 description

环境

Adobe Experience Platform (AEP)

问题/症状

选择数据 步骤中编辑Snowflake数据流时,会引发以下错误,这会阻止您继续使用该工作流。

由于预览期间发生超时错误,无法加载示例数据。
您仍可以查看架构预览,但不查看示例数据。 这样做可能会导致在映射步骤中未验证计算字段和必填字段,然后您必须在映射时手动验证这些字段。

启用 跳过预览示例数据 切换后,页面加载几分钟,并抛出:

此API调用响应时间过长,即使没有数据预览也是如此。 请优化数据源或稍后重试。

解决方法 resolution

请按照以下步骤解决问题:

  1. 直接在Snowflake中运行以下查询以检查查询执行时间:

    SELECT * FROM <view/table> LIMIT 100;

    如果这需要30秒以上的时间,则可能是导致超时的原因。

  2. 如果查询位于 视图 上,请检查基础SQL查询是否存在性能瓶颈。 在适用的情况下,可以考虑优化联接、早期过滤、使用实例化视图或编制索引。

  3. 如果查询仍然需要很长时间,请考虑临时增加Snowflake中的仓库大小,以查看性能是否提高。

    注意 如果仓库大小已更改,请确保 AEP源 用户界面中的连接/帐户反映该更新。

相关阅读

recommendation-more-help
3d58f420-19b5-47a0-a122-5c9dab55ec7f